How to pair Jabra hearing aids connect to my MacBook Pro?

I want to pair my Jabra hearing aids with my MacBook Pro. I have them paired with my iPhone but can’t figure out how to pair them with my MacBook

See information in Use hearing devices with your Mac - Apple Support including the following:


Note: Made for iPhone hearing devices can be paired only with select Mac computers with the M1 chip, and all Mac computers with the M2 or M3 chip. For a list of supported hearing devices and more information about Mac system requirements, see the Apple Support article List of Made for iPhone hearing devices.


I believe that it also requires macOS Sonoma 14.2 or later.
